Republic Bank (Ghana) PLC has appointed Mrs. Elsie Enninful-Adu as a Non-Executive Director of its Board, effective August 3, 2026. The appointment was made following approval by the Bank of Ghana.

Mrs. Enninful-Adu brings more than 30 years of experience in Ghana’s financial services sector, with expertise spanning investment management, private equity and venture capital, corporate finance, capital markets, credit risk, strategic planning, advisory services and sustainable investment.

She also has more than two decades of executive-level experience, as well as significant exposure to corporate governance and regulatory matters. She is currently an Executive Director of Parkstone Capital, where she leads the provision of advisory services to clients in the financial, legal, education and hospitality sectors.

Before joining Parkstone Capital, Mrs. Enninful-Adu served as Team Lead of the Ghana CARES Guarantee Scheme (GCGS), managed by GIRSAL Limited. In that role, she helped establish the Scheme’s operational systems and measurement frameworks and led a team responsible for assessing and processing credit guarantee applications.

Her career also includes senior roles in strategic planning, money markets, corporate finance and advisory services within the financial services industry.

Mrs. Enninful-Adu holds a Master of Business Administration in International Banking and Finance from the University of Birmingham, as well as a Bachelor of Commerce and a Diploma in Education from the University of Cape Coast. She is also a Certified Valuation Analyst (CVA) of the National Association of Certified Valuators & Analysts (NACVA), USA, and has completed several courses offered by the Ghana Stock Exchange.

Welcoming the appointment, Chairman of the Board of Republic Bank (Ghana) PLC, Jonathan Prince Cann, said Mrs. Enninful-Adu’s experience would strengthen the bank’s governance and strategic capabilities.

“We are delighted to welcome Mrs. Enninful-Adu as a Non-Executive Director of the Republic Bank Ghana Board. Her extensive experience across financial services, investment management, corporate finance and governance, together with her deep understanding of Ghana’s financial sector, will be a valuable addition to the Bank,” he said.

He added that the bank was confident her expertise would contribute to its continued growth and strategic ambitions.

Managing Director of Republic Bank (Ghana) PLC, Dr. Benjamin Dzoboku, also welcomed the appointment, describing Mrs. Enninful-Adu’s leadership experience and track record as valuable to the bank.

“Mrs. Enninful-Adu’s breadth of experience and strong track record of leadership make her a valuable addition to Republic Bank. We look forward to working with her as we advance our strategic priorities,” he said.

The bank said the appointment forms part of its efforts to strengthen its leadership and governance capabilities as it pursues its strategic growth agenda and seeks to deepen its contribution to Ghana’s financial sector.
